September 11, 2024
Turku
OTHER
October 21, 2024
Helsinki
OTHER
View DetailsOctober 21, 2024
Helsinki
OTHER
View DetailsOctober 20, 2024
Helsinki
View DetailsSeptember 19, 2024
Helsinki
OTHER
View DetailsOctober 4, 2024
Tampere
View Details